Structure, tree diversity, and aboveground carbon stocks of smallholder farms with push-pull technology in western Kenya

open access: yesTrees, Forests and People
Push-pull technology is a companion cropping system whose success in soil fertility improvement and management of agricultural pests has been established in cereal-based systems.

Influence of an Argon/Silane Atmosphere on the Temperature of a Thermal Plasma

open access: yesAdvanced Engineering Materials, EarlyView.
The influence of a silane‐doped argon atmosphere on the chemical composition and temperature of a thermal nontransferring argon plasma is investigated using optical emission spectroscopy. Fluorinated Metal–Organic Framework–Polymer Mixed Matrix Membrane with Tunable Hydrophobic Channel for Efficient Pervaporation of Butanol/Water

open access: yesSmall Structures
The permeability–selectivity trade‐off of membrane is a major challenge limiting the development of pervaporation (PV) technology. Rational design of high‐performance mixed matrix membranes (MMMs) has the potential to break off the trade‐off.
